DiMarzio D Activator Humbucker Bridge

The DiMarzio D Activator Bridge Humbucker has been carefully designed to bring the sound and tonal characteristics of active pickups without the disadvantage of lowered dynamics and the need for a battery.

Great for heavier music like Rock, Metal and punk, the D Activator remains versatile. Incredibly harmonic rich and hot to give you that ultimate gain!

The D Activator™ bridge has an enriched harmonic quality and the notes want to sing. Both the D Activator™ neck and bridge pickups were designed to eliminate the sterile edginess commonly associated with active pickups. The D Activators™ use coils tuned to different frequencies. The idea is to shift the resonant point of the pickup to the frequencies of the harmonics that you want to accentuate from the guitar.The D Activator™ bridge pickup is about 25% louder than the D Activator™ neck. Since DiMarzio was developing both pickups from the ground up as a set, they adjusted the volume levels on the pickups so they are balanced. That way when you switch from the neck to the bridge, you don’t hear a drop in volume, another common problem with active pickups.

Recommended For: Bridge

Tech Talk: An interesting fact about the most popular active bridge pickups is that they aren’t incredibly loud. Instead, they have a strong, focused attack that hits the amp very hard and makes them ‘feel’ more powerful than they actually spec out to be. This is an important characteristic that DiMarzio needed to capture with the D Activator™ bridge pickup. They also wanted to avoid the limiting effect that can occur with active pickups when they are played hard. DiMarzio's pickup is passive with a lot of headroom, and it responds quickly and accurately to changes in pick attack. A hard pick attack doesn’t cause the signal to flatten out, and picking more softly or rolling the volume control down lets the sound clean up naturally.

Like all passive pickups, D Activators™ require controls with a minimum value of 250Kohms. 500K is the standard all around value, and DiMarzio's 1Megohm tone control is best for long cable runs.

Specifications

  • Wiring : 4 Conductor
  • Magnet : Ceramic
  • Output : 470
  • DC Resistance : 11.41

Tone Guide (Out of 10)

  • Treble : 6.5
  • Mid : 6
  • Bass : 6

Subject:Killer Harmonics and Very Quiet
Quality: The D Activator bridge is not covered and/or vacuum sealed, but it's matte finish IMO is perfect for a long life. It doesn't run on batteries; those have a tendency to eventually run down and degrade tone.
Reliability: I've had D Activators in my main axe for a whole year + and they have stood up over this period.
Overall: I feel this bridge pickup is good for high clarity and punchy music, when high output is required. Obviously a great alternative to active pickups. Tonally it might not suit everyone, but for the characteristics it displays, it may even persuade the most discriminating of tone hunters.
Playability and Feel: It's all about it's focused attack. Not about it's tone necessarily as it is about it's attack. The treble strings are nothing but metal lines leading to Pinch Harmonic City. Pretty heavy sounding, but not the heaviest.
Tone: Pretty balanced sounding, but when you hit the treble strings, it can feel like the treble frequency is more present, but that really isn't the case I'd say. Not too dark and not too bright. Very hot. Tube amps are going to get the full measure of the attack. It works well with solidstate amps too. Not too thick these pickups, but also not too thin. Very nice sustain. The D Activator has alot of headroom, so the initial attack of the strings effect doesn't diminish because the pickups design can't handle the info. The 'active' pickup tone is clean and open sounding and has a nice tone under heavy gain.
Finish: Matte. It's just a nice, long wearing finish. I prefer it over a polished finish.
Action: Everything was up to par. Both neck and bridge pickups.
